3.9.4 Gas Sensor - Zero Calibration

Siaretron4000e
WARNING !! Risk of failure of ventilator and/or injury to the patient.
Gas sensor - Zero Reference Calibration : this procedure, to be used
to perform the zeroing of gas analyzer, is ENABLED only when:
gas sensor is connected to the RS-232 connector placed on side of
the ventilator (please refer to the GAZ ANALYZER manual).
the function IRMA/ISA could be activated in the CALIBRATION
PROGRAM (please, refer to chapter 4.13).
Sidestream ISA sensor: the zeroing of gas analyzer measurement
is activated in automatic mode.
Mainstream IRMA sensor: after around one minute from the gas
analyzer is turned on, it is necessary to perform the manual
procedure of zero calibration.
It is possible to perform the zero calibration of the gas analyzer also
by the parameters: MENU - SETUP - GAS SENSOR.
Turn the encoder knob to select
the parameter to be calibrated:
the activated message is
highlighted.
Press the knob; the system will
activate the Gas Sensor: Zero
Reference Calibration.
NOTE. This procedure should be
performed only with IRMA gas
analyzer.
Zeroing calibration procedure is
in progress.
